Abstract

An improved tracer for use with electrographic surfaces which employs reticle components including crosshairs and a sighting circle which additionally functions to provide capacitive coupling. Formed of a conductive material such as chromium, these components are geometric regular shape and somewhat concentrated at the center portion of the reticle targeting center. As such, the device is capable of achieving a close correspondence between actual physical targeting location and resultant digitized coordinate readout. These components further achieve an avoidance of inaccuracies due to active surface border influences. The reticle-capacitive coupling components are placed on one side of a transparent disk, the opposite or upwardly disposed surface of which is coated with a transparent electrically conductive material such as indium tin oxide. This upwardly disposed conductive layer is coupled with ground and there results a dissipation of spurious signals which otherwise may influence the performance of the device.
